A blend of Mediterranean grape varieties, mainly Garnacha and Cariñena. Delicate raspberry color. Fragrant, with fruity notes reminiscent of quince jam against a redcurrant backdrop. Firm, flavorful, warm palate with exquisitely fine fruit acidity.
“Made from carefully selected vineyards, this iconic wine has stayed true to its incomparable personality since the first vintage in 1954."

A blend, mainly Parellada and White Garnacha. Clear, clean, bright gold in color. Fresh, full of fruit, with fine citrus aromas. Silky, with subtle acidity and a delicate midpalate.
“In the summer of 1962, at a small winery in the coastal hills of the Mediterranean, we first made Viña Sol, the classic essence of earth and sun."
100% Tempranillo. Dark cherry red with purple highlights. Fragrant and intense, with deep fruit notes (raspberry) against a licorice backdrop. A fine, velvety, warm palate with a touch of sweetness.

Moscatel de Alejandría and Gewürztraminer. Brilliant straw yellow. Very fragrant, with delicate floral (rose) and fruit (lychee) notes. Soft and seductive on the palate with a luscious (acacia honey) finish.
“The Mediterranean breeze blends with the scent of roses, which grow around our vineyards further inland, to bring us our most cherished gem: Viña Esmeralda. A pleasure to share that evokes the beauty of the Mediterranean and its unique places."
